Klaudiusz Dembler 4 năm trước cách đây
mục cha
commit
8ccd687042
3 tập tin đã thay đổi với 23 bổ sung22 xóa
  1. 2 1
      babel.config.json
  2. 14 0
      package.json
  3. 7 21
      packages/app/package.json

+ 2 - 1
babel.config.json

@@ -4,5 +4,6 @@
 		"@babel/preset-react",
 		"@babel/preset-typescript",
 		"@emotion/babel-preset-css-prop"
-	]
+	],
+	"babelrcRoots": ["*", "packages/*"]
 }

+ 14 - 0
package.json

@@ -24,6 +24,18 @@
 		"@babel/preset-react": "^7.8.3",
 		"@babel/preset-typescript": "^7.9.0",
 		"@emotion/babel-preset-css-prop": "^10.0.27",
+		"@fortawesome/fontawesome-svg-core": "^1.2.28",
+		"@fortawesome/free-solid-svg-icons": "^5.13.0",
+		"@fortawesome/react-fontawesome": "^0.1.9",
+		"@storybook/addon-actions": "^5.3.17",
+		"@storybook/addon-docs": "^5.3.17",
+		"@storybook/addon-knobs": "^5.3.17",
+		"@storybook/addon-links": "^5.3.17",
+		"@storybook/addon-storysource": "^5.3.17",
+		"@storybook/addons": "^5.3.19",
+		"@storybook/react": "^5.3.17",
+		"@storybook/theming": "^5.3.19",
+		"@svgr/webpack": "^5.4.0",
 		"@typescript-eslint/eslint-plugin": "^3.2.0",
 		"@typescript-eslint/parser": "^3.2.0",
 		"babel-loader": "^8.0.6",
@@ -41,6 +53,8 @@
 		"lerna": "^3.20.2",
 		"lint-staged": "^10.2.7",
 		"prettier": "^2.0.5",
+		"react-docgen-typescript-loader": "^3.7.1",
+		"storybook-addon-jsx": "^7.1.15",
 		"ts-loader": "^6.2.1",
 		"typescript": "^3.8.3"
 	}

+ 7 - 21
packages/app/package.json

@@ -30,38 +30,24 @@
 	},
 	"dependencies": {
 		"@emotion/core": "^10.0.28",
+		"@parcel/transformer-svg-react": "^2.0.0-nightly.1739",
+		"@parcel/transformer-svgo": "^2.0.0-nightly.1739",
 		"@reach/router": "^1.3.3",
 		"@types/reach__router": "^1.3.5",
 		"@types/react": "^16.9.36",
 		"@types/react-dom": "^16.9.8",
 		"@types/react-redux": "^7.1.9",
 		"@types/redux": "^3.6.0",
+		"chromatic": "^4.0.3",
 		"emotion-normalize": "^10.1.0",
+		"parcel": "^2.0.0-beta.1",
 		"react": "^16.13.1",
 		"react-dom": "^16.13.1",
-		"react-redux": "^7.2.0",
-		"redux": "^4.0.5",
 		"react-player": "^2.2.0",
+		"react-redux": "^7.2.0",
 		"react-spring": "^8.0.27",
-		"use-resize-observer": "^6.1.0",
-		"chromatic": "^4.0.3",
-		"react-docgen-typescript-loader": "^3.7.1",
-		"storybook-addon-jsx": "^7.1.15",
-		"parcel": "^2.0.0-beta.1",
-		"@fortawesome/fontawesome-svg-core": "^1.2.28",
-		"@fortawesome/free-solid-svg-icons": "^5.13.0",
-		"@fortawesome/react-fontawesome": "^0.1.9",
-		"@parcel/transformer-svg-react": "^2.0.0-nightly.1739",
-		"@parcel/transformer-svgo": "^2.0.0-nightly.1739",
-		"@storybook/addon-actions": "^5.3.17",
-		"@storybook/addon-docs": "^5.3.17",
-		"@storybook/addon-knobs": "^5.3.17",
-		"@storybook/addon-links": "^5.3.17",
-		"@storybook/addon-storysource": "^5.3.17",
-		"@storybook/addons": "^5.3.19",
-		"@storybook/react": "^5.3.17",
-		"@storybook/theming": "^5.3.19",
-		"@svgr/webpack": "^5.4.0"
+		"redux": "^4.0.5",
+		"use-resize-observer": "^6.1.0"
 	},
 	"alias": {
 		"components": "./src/components",